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Lancing to Branksome start from £27.00 one way, or £27.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Lancing to Branksome are available for £27.90 one way, or £33.60 return

Lancing Station Facilities and Services

At Lancing train station, buying tickets is hassle-free. The ticket office operates from early morning until late evening, making it easy for commuters and travelers to access tickets at their convenience. Whether you're catching the first train or heading back on a late-night service, you can purchase your tickets at one of the station's machines, which are designed with accessibility in mind. If you've bought tickets online, simply collect them at the handy ticket machine.

In terms of accessibility, Lancing station does a decent job, offering step-free access to both platforms via separate entrances. This is especially helpful for travelers with reduced mobility or those carrying heavy luggage. However, it's worth noting there are no waiting rooms or accessible toilets on site. If you need help or support, assistance can be pre-booked, and staff are available during office hours to ensure your journey goes smoothly.

Connections and Local Transport Links

Whether you're a local or a visitor, Lancing train station provides a variety of onward travel options to suit your needs. For those looking to travel further without a car, a taxi rank is conveniently situated at the front of the station. Local buses extend your travel choices, making it easy to reach nearby towns and attractions. For cycling enthusiasts, the station offers bike storage, but do bear in mind that there are no hire facilities on site.

Facilities at Branksome Station

When it comes to facilities, Branksome Train Station offers basic necessities to ensure a pleasant journey. The ticket office is open Monday through Saturday but closed on Sundays, with self-service ticket machines available for convenience. Accessible ticket machines are available that allow for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, making it easier for everyone to purchase tickets.

While the station is a step-free category C hub, it’s important to note that there are steps to access both platforms. Assistance for boarding and alighting is provided by the train guard, ensuring safe travel for all passengers. Other amenities include induction loops for those who are hard of hearing and a payphone to stay connected. However, the station lacks some modern conveniences like waiting rooms, toilet facilities, and refreshment kiosks, so you might want to plan ahead if you anticipate a long wait.

Getting To and From Branksome Station

Transport options to and from Branksome Station are conveniently integrated to accommodate your further travel needs. For those requiring a rail replacement service, buses to Bournemouth and Poole pick up and drop off on Poole Road, directly outside and opposite John Lewis. This makes it easy to switch from train to road transportation when necessary.

If you’re planning to explore the local area or need assistance plotting your onward journey, useful travel information can be accessed via a printable guide available online. Additionally, the station offers sheltered bicycle racks with CCTV to provide peace of mind for cyclists. Although there are no direct cycle hire options, cycling remains a viable commuting option owing to secured parking facilities.
